@charset "UTF-8";  

.scrollView {
  opacity: 1 !important;
}

/* フェードイン */
.fadein {
	opacity : 0;
	-webkit-transform: transform: translateY(20px);
	transform: translateY(20px);
	transition : all 1000ms;
}
.fadein.scrollin {
	opacity : 1;
	-webkit-transform: transform: translateY(0px);
	transform: translateY(0px);
}
@keyframes kv_scroll {
	from {
		-webkit-transform: translate3d(0, 0, 0);
		transform: translate3d(0, 0, 0);
	}
	10% {
		-webkit-transform: translate3d(0, 0, 0);
		transform: translate3d(0, 0, 0);
	}
	35% {
		opacity: 1;
		-webkit-transform: translate3d(0, 145px, 0);
		transform: translate3d(0, 145px, 0);
	}
	55% {
		opacity: 0;
		-webkit-transform: translate3d(0, 145px, 0);
		transform: translate3d(0, 145px, 0);
	}
	60% {
		opacity: 0;
		-webkit-transform: translate3d(0, 0, 0);
		transform: translate3d(0, 0, 0);
	}
	100% {
		opacity: 1;
		-webkit-transform: translate3d(0, 0, 0);
		transform: translate3d(0, 0, 0);
	}
}